About 3 Robin Hood Cottages
3 Robin Hood Cottages is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Standford, Bordon, Bordon (GU35 8RA). It has a recorded floor area of 89 m² (around 958 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(December 2019) shows an E (score 41),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The rating has held steady at E across 3 certificates since June 2017.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Very Poor to Average and hot-water efficiency went from Very Poor to Good; while roof efficiency dropped from Poor to Very Poor and lighting dropped from Very Good to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 78), a 2-band jump. Our model identifies extension potential, subject to local planning policy.
At 89 m² it sits well below the postcode median (135 m² across 4 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. Across 2020–2021, sale prices on this property compounded at 6.3%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£358,000 is 25.6%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£297/sq ft) was about 18.7%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old September 2021 for £285,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end. One historical planning record sits against the property in 2020.
